The outbreak of the coronavirus disrupted container traffic at major container ports in Asia in February and Shanghai port faced a nearly 20 percent drop in box throughput while the Maritime & Port Authority of Singapore (MPA) reported a positive growth in volumes at the port of Singapore.
Shanghai International Port (Group) has said it handled 229.8 million TEUs in February, representing a double-digit decline of 19.5% compared to 285.5 million TEUs in the same month of 2019. For the first two months, box traffic fell 10.6% to 6.607 million TEUs.
According to MPA, the port handled 2.90 million TEUs in February 2020, up 5.8% year-on-year. For the first two months, volumes were up 5.9% at 6.08 million TEUs compared to 5.74 million TEUs in the same period a year earlier.
